Pillars mark 7/7's 'unique' victims

A £1m memorial to the 52 victims of the 7 July bombings on London's transport system is being unveiled in Hyde Park.

Tuesday marks four years since the attacks in Edgware Road, Russell Square, Aldgate and Tavistock Square.

June Kelly visited the memorial with relatives of two of those who lost their lives.
